Product snapshot: Gypsum retarder (technical view)

From HeBei ShengShi HongBang Cellulose Technology CO., LTD (Room 1904, Building B, Wanda Office Building, JiaoYu Road, Xinji City, Hebei Province), the formulation is tuned for consistent set control across stucco, hand-applied plaster, jointing compounds, and self-leveling gypsum. The big idea: delay nucleation/growth of calcium sulfate dihydrate crystals without gutting strength.

Form Free-flowing powder
Typical dosage ≈0.02%–0.10% by weight of binder (real-world use may vary)
Set-time extension +30 to +120 minutes at 23°C, 50% RH (per ASTM C472 style testing)
Chloride/VOC Chloride-free; low VOC
Compatibility Gypsum hemihydrate α/β, fillers, HPMC, starch ethers, pigments
Shelf life 12–24 months in dry, sealed bags

Where it’s used (and why crews like it)

  • Machine/hand-applied interior plasters needing uniform workability
  • Drywall joint compounds resisting “flash set” in warm rooms
  • Self-leveling gypsum underlayments seeking longer flow life
  • Decorative moldings and GFRG parts—clean demold, fewer defects

Advantages that keep coming up: steadier pumpability, less re-tempering, fewer cold joints, and a calmer crew rhythm. Many customers say productivity increases once the set is predictable. I guess that’s not surprising.

Process flow, methods, and testing

Materials: gypsum binder, water, HPMC/cellulose ether, Plaster Retarder, fillers. Method: dry blend the retarder uniformly; dose low and climb; check slump and setting. Testing: initial/final set per ASTM C472 or EN 13279-1; strength via prisms; temperature drift checks (15–35°C). Service life in use: set-control consistency across batches; installed systems follow substrate/service expectations.

Internal lab snapshot (23±2°C, 50±5% RH, ASTM C472): base gypsum initial set 12±2 min; with 0.06% Plaster Retarder → 70±5 min; compressive strength retention at 7 days ≈96–100% vs. control. That’s the sweet spot.

Customization + a quick case

Hot-climate apartment towers, Gulf region. Pumped gypsum plaster kept flashing at 34°C. After trials, 0.05→0.08% Plaster Retarder plus minor water reduction stabilized initial set from ~25 to ~85 minutes; rework dropped ≈30%. Contractor feedback: “Crew pace finally matched truck cycle—less waste, cleaner finish.” Strength at 7 days held at 97% of control; edges showed fewer cold joints.

How to specify smartly

  • Reference ASTM C472 or EN 13279-1 set-time targets in QA plans
  • Request data for 15/23/35°C—temperature sensitivity matters
  • Check compatibility with your HPMC grade and pigments
  • Ask for retained strength and chloride/VOC statements; look for ISO 9001

Bottom line: a well-dosed Plaster Retarder is low cost, high leverage. Trial your mix, tune the curve, then lock in the spec.
